Oxetane Derivatives and Their Polymers for Designing Functional Polymers Containing a Soft, Somewhat Polar Polyether Network as a Polymer Support

Several oxetane derivatives having functional groups, such as ester, ketone, ether, acetal, and azo, at the end of 2-oxapolymethylene spacers which were linked to the C-3 carbon of an oxetane ring were readily prepared by a substitution reaction of the corresponding bromide of the oxetane.
